This game is one of a series of 2 player strategy games by Lakeside from the 1970's, also including Blockade, Trespass, and Isolation. In Overboard, the "Slide to Survive" game, the board is a 7x7 grid of squares with slots between them to create a grid of 6x6 or 36 playing positions. There are 36 pieces, 18 red, 18 white, which are placed on the intersections between the squares; they have little knobs which hold them in the slots. On his turn, a player uses one of his pieces to push a row of his opponent's pieces off the board, a la Kuba. The winner is the last player with pieces on the board.
